Title: Boundary layer and spike layer solutions for a bistable elliptic problem with generalized boundary conditions

Abstract: We show that for large λ>0, the 'generalized' boundary value problem −Δu = λu(u − a(x))(1 − u) in Ω, u|∂Ω = ø, where 1≼ø(x)≼∞, behaves like the special case ø ≡ 1. In particular, we show the existence of solutions with sharp boundary layers and interior spikes, and determine the location of the spikes.
